#ozgecmisProfileImgContainer {
    height: 65%;
}

#ozgecmisProfileImg {
    object-fit: contain;
    height: 100%;
    display: block;
    margin: auto;
}

#ozgecmisBenKimim {
    margin-top: 0.5rem;
}

#ozgecmisIcerik {
    overflow-y: scroll;
}

.ozgecmis__bolum h3 {
    display: inline-block;
    margin-bottom: 0;
}


#ozgecmisDeneyim h3{
    margin-top: 0;
}

.ozgecmis__bolum h4 {
    margin-top: 1rem;
    margin-bottom: 0;
    display: inline-block;
}
/*TODO: ozgecmisBenKimim responsive için düzenlenmeli.*/

.ozgecmis__body {
    margin: 0 1rem;
}

.ozgecmis__nesne {

    display: flex;
    align-items: flex-start;
    margin-bottom: 0.5rem;
}
.ozgecmis__yil {
    width: 13%;
    display: inline-block;
    padding-top: 0;
    padding-right: 0.5rem;
    padding-bottom: 0;
    padding-left: 0.5rem;
    text-align: left;
}

.ozgecmis__yil p {
    margin-top: 0;
}

.ozgecmis__bilgi {
    width: 88%;
    display: inline-block;
}

.referans__yazar {

}

.referans__title {

}
.referans__yayın_yeri {
    font-style: italic;
}

.referans__vol {

}

.referans__yil {

}

@media screen and (max-width: 980px) {
    /* mobile */

    #ozgecmisProfileImgContainer {
        height: 100%;
    }

    #ozgecmisBenKimim {
        font-size: 1.5rem;
    }

    .container {

    }
    .container__viewport__narrow {
        display: flex;
        width: 100vw;
        height: 40vh;
        box-shadow: 0 5px 10px rgba(91, 158, 166, 0.3);
        margin-left: 0.5rem;
        margin-right: 0.5rem;
    }

    .container__viewport__wide {
        width: 100vw;
        height: 50vh;
    }


    .ozgecmis__bolum h3 {
      /*  font-size: 2.5rem; */
      margin-left: 2rem;
      margin-right: 1rem;
      margin-bottom: 0.5rem;
    }

    .ozgecmis__body {
        margin-left: 2rem;
    }

    .ozgecmis__yil {
        width: 20%;
    }
}
